Job Description
We are seeking a Linguistic Engineer to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have strong experience in LLM data pipeline workflows, data quality assessment, and dataset curation and a proven ability to build, maintain, and analyze datasets that drive accurate and reliable LLM-powered features for smart glasses applications.
Responsibilities:
- Aggregate cross-functional requests and translate them into actionable, high-quality datasets using synthetic data collections and live user traffic.
- Deliver analytics, statistics, and model performance results on curated datasets.
- Design and conduct experiments to evaluate rater quality and inter-rater reliability, write summary reports, and present findings.
- Develop manual and automated processes across concurrent projects to ensure high-quality labeled data.
- Create and refine LLM quality grading queues and error attribution queues for LLM components.
- Build datasets and write clear guidelines rapidly for emergent LLM data rating, creation, and annotation needs.
- Analyze system metrics such as factuality, brevity, coherence, and subcomponent performance, summarize insights, and communicate results.
